Abstract

The invention relates to a three-dimensional printer which comprises a bottom beam and a longitudinal guide rail perpendicular to the bottom beam, wherein a printing platform capable of moving in the length direction of the longitudinal guide rail is arranged on the longitudinal guide rail; the two ends of the bottom beam are separately equipped with a left supporting rail and a right supporting rail; a feeding beam is transversely arranged between the two supporting rails; the two ends of the feeding beam are separately in rolling fit with the left supporting rail and the right supporting rail; a drive mechanism used for controlling the feeding beam to move up and down is arranged on the bottom beam; a feeding base capable of moving in the length direction of the feeding beam is arranged on the feeding beam; and a feeding spray head is arranged in the feeding base. According to the printer, a transmission structure is simple and stable, so that the feeding beam is stable up and down, the feeding base transversely moves stably, and the printing platform stably moves front and back.

technical field [0001] The invention relates to a three-dimensional printer. Background technique [0002] 3D (Three Dimensions in English, three-dimensional in Chinese) printing technology is based on the computer three-dimensional design model, through the software layered discrete and numerical control molding system, using laser beams and hot-melt nozzles to process metal powder, ceramic powder, plastic and Special materials such as cell tissue are piled up and bonded layer by layer, and finally superimposed to form a physical product. Unlike the traditional manufacturing industry that shapes or cuts raw materials to produce finished products through mechanical processing such as molds or turning and milling, 3D printing transforms a three-dimensional entity into several two-dimensional planes, and produces by processing materials and superimposing them layer by layer, thereby greatly The manufacturing complexity is reduced.
